What's Driving Ripple Price Today?
The XRP price surge to $3.36 stems primarily from Ripple's strategic acquisition of Rail, a stablecoin infrastructure company, announced yesterday for $200 million. This move significantly strengthens Ripple's position in the competitive $279 billion stablecoin market, particularly enhancing capabilities for its RLUSD token.
Market sentiment has turned decisively positive as investors anticipate the SEC's decision on Ripple's appeal withdrawal. The regulatory clarity this could provide has pushed XRP price beyond the $3 psychological barrier, with the token breaking through multiple resistance levels in the past 24 hours.
Adding to the bullish momentum, Ripple's RLUSD stablecoin has secured institutional backing from major players including BNY Mellon as custodian and Swiss AMINA Bank as the first direct banking supporter. This institutional adoption validates Ripple's broader ecosystem beyond XRP trading.
The company's valuation milestone of $15 billion, ranking 23rd among global private companies according to CB Insights, further reinforces investor confidence. This valuation surpasses established firms like Klarna, highlighting Ripple's growing market position.
However, the recent rally follows a challenging period where XRP price declined 9% earlier this week due to institutional selling pressure, finding temporary support at $2.75 before the current recovery.
XRP Technical Analysis: Strong Bullish Signals Emerge
Ripple technical analysis reveals robust bullish momentum across multiple timeframes. XRP's RSI reading of 62.94 indicates healthy buying pressure without reaching overbought territory, suggesting room for further upside movement.
The XRP/USDT pair is trading well above all major moving averages, with the current $3.36 price significantly higher than the 200-day SMA at $2.45. This positioning above long-term averages confirms the strong bullish trend that has characterized XRP price action.
XRP's MACD shows a slight bearish divergence with the histogram at -0.0080, though the overall MACD remains positive at 0.0853. This suggests short-term consolidation rather than trend reversal, particularly given the strong underlying fundamentals.
The Bollinger Bands analysis shows XRP trading at 75.43% of the band width, approaching the upper band at $3.56. This positioning indicates strong momentum while highlighting potential resistance ahead.
Ripple's stochastic indicators paint an extremely bullish picture, with %K at 97.04 and %D at 79.43, suggesting XRP price maintains strong upward momentum despite being in overbought territory on this oscillator.
